Section 500.2652 - Rating organizations; rating information to insured, appeal to insurance commissioner.

THE INSURANCE CODE OF 1956 (EXCERPT)
Act 218 of 1956

500.2652 Rating organizations; rating information to insured, appeal to insurance commissioner.

Sec. 2652.

Every rating organization and every insurer which makes its own rates shall, within a reasonable time after receiving written request therefor and upon payment of such reasonable charge as it may make, furnish to any insured affected by a rate made by it, or to the authorized representative of such insured, all pertinent information as to such rate. Every rating organization and every insurer which makes its own rates shall provide within this state reasonable means whereby any person aggrieved by the application of its rating system may be heard, in person or by his authorized representative, on his written request to review the manner in which such rating system has been applied in connection with the insurance afforded him. If the rating organization or insurer fails to grant or reject such request within 30 days after it is made, the applicant may proceed in the same manner as if his application had been rejected. Any party affected by the action of such rating organization or such insurer on such request may, within 30 days after written notice of such action, appeal to the commissioner, who, after a hearing held upon not less than 10 days' written notice to the appellant and to such rating organization or insurer, may affirm or reverse such action.


History: 1956, Act 218, Eff. Jan. 1, 1957
